ENCORE TRUE DUAL MONO AMPLIFIER
Instructions

UNPACKING

The packing box for the Encore Amplifier
should arrive in good condition. Please
look for damage to the carton, although
this is most unlikely due to the strength of
the carton construction. Cut and open
packing carefully and save all foam pieces
and boxes for reuse in the event that the
unit must be shipped in the future.
Should the boxes become lost, please
contact the factory for replacement
cartons.
The carton should contain:
■ Encore Amplifier
■ 2 A.C. cables
■ torx wrench

INSTALLATION

Be certain that the amplifiers are installed
so that they have proper ventilation.
Placing the units in small, close-fitting
enclosures is not recommended. Room air
temperature should not exceed 122
degrees F./50 degrees C.

SELECTION OF AUDIO CABLES

Any high quality RCA cables may be used.
For balanced line connections, we strongly
suggest using Cello Strings cable made to
factory specifications. Improperly
constructed cables cause problems. It
takes equipment and experience to make
high quality balanced line terminations.
Cello Strings are available in any desired
length, with a variety of connectors, for
different system requirements.

CONNECTION

(See connection identification diagram
on page A1.)
1) Make sure the power switches located
on the rear panel of the amplifiers
are "OFF."
2) Verify that the amplifiers are set to the
same A.C. mains voltage as the A.C.
mains in your home or studio. (A.C.
mains voltage is labeled on the rear
panel of the amplifier.)
3) Connect the preamplifier outputs or
other driving equipment outputs to
the amplifier inputs located on the
rear panel.
4) Connect speaker cables to speaker
outputs on the rear panel. Be sure to
keep the spade terminal from rotating
while turning the the screw. Tighten
until there is zero play, then apply an
additional 1/8th turn to make the
connection snug.
CAUTION: Do not over-tighten, as
you will break the terminal strip.
5) Install the A.C. cords into the I.E.C.
mains connectors located on the
rear panel.
6) Connect the A.C. cords to the A.C.
outlets in your home or studio.
NOTE: Do not run A.C. cords, audio
signal or speaker cables under rugs or
sharp objects where they may be damaged.

OPERATION

CAUTION: Do not operate this device if
physical damage has occurred to unit, or
if the unit has been exposed to water or
other liquids, until proper repairs and/or
unit integrity tests have been effected by
authorized personnel.
1) Be sure all electrical connections are
correct and secure. Triple check them.
2) Turn peripheral units on first. Avoid
switching these units on and off while
amplifier is on.
3) Set volume control on preamplifier to
minimum.
4) Turn amplifier switches to "ON"
position.
5) Begin source material (turntable, tuner,
CD, etc.) and raise preamplifier volume
control to desired listening level. Enjoy!
NOTE: To remove amplifier from
system, turn down volume then turn
amplifiers "OFF" and reverse steps for
connection.

BRIDGED OPERATION

(See connection identification diagram
on page A2.)
One pair of Encore Amplifier units may
be used as a mono amplifier in bridged
mode. This provides four times the
regular power.
CAUTION: Bridged operation should
only be carried out with the recommen-
dation of the speaker manufacturer.
A bridging kit (P/N: 75-3410-00) is
required to operate Encore Amplifiers in
bridged mode. The kit may be purchased
from your Cello System Designer or
ordered directly from the factory.
